Augustana College Clinic For Speech, Language, and Hearing
The Augustana College Clinic for Speech, Language, and Hearing, located at 851 34th Street in Rock Island, Illinois, is home to The Roseman Center for Speech, Language, and Hearing. This center, housed in Brodahl Hall at 761 34th St., offers a range of speech-language and audiology services to individuals of all ages with communication disorders. The clinic serves as an on-campus internship site for undergraduate students majoring in Communication Sciences and Disorders, as well as students in the Master of Science in Speech-Language Pathology program. Services provided at The Roseman Center include assessment and intervention for speech, language, and reading and writing disorders. These services are conducted by student clinicians under the supervision of experienced faculty members who hold advanced degrees in speech-language pathology and are licensed by the State of Illinois. The clinic accepts referrals from healthcare providers and self-referrals for diagnostic and intervention services.
